Climbing Giant Vine

Climbing plant type: Vine (Grows upwards by clinging to almost any surface.)

This massive vine is a slow growing plant, with the largest known specimen reaching a length of 2,995 feet (912.9 meters) and growing as high as 424 feet (129.2 meters).

It takes 22 years for the lime green or gentle purple stems to mature, by which point they can have a diameter of 1.9 feet (58 cm) and are smooth and woody.

The finger-like, smooth leaves reach up to 2.4 feet (74 cm) in length. They are grey and brown, and have jagged edges.

During late spring, the vine produces a thick sheet of small caramel flowers, and during the early winter, after flowering, it produces plenty of small berries.


It is suitable for use as a construction material
